CVE-2016-4072

Description

The Phar extension in PHP before 5.5.34, 5.6.x before 5.6.20, and 7.x before 7.0.5 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via a crafted filename, as demonstrated by mishandling of characters by the phar_analyze_path function in ext/phar/phar.c.
